>  Q&A  >  본문

java - 세션의 기본 만료 시간은 30분입니다. 이는 세션 생성 후 30분을 의미합니까, 아니면 마지막으로 세션에 액세스한 후 30분을 의미합니까?

저건 어때요? 모르겠어요

给我你的怀抱给我你的怀抱2712일 전558

모든 응답(3)나는 대답할 것이다

  • 仅有的幸福

    仅有的幸福2017-05-17 10:09:34

    은 마지막 방문 이후이며 30분 동안 방문하지 않으면 만료됩니다.

    첫 번째 상황이라면 사용자가 사용 중에 로그인 상태를 잃어서 다시 로그인해야 하는 상황이 너무 안타깝습니다.

    회신하다
    0
  • 仅有的幸福

    仅有的幸福2017-05-17 10:09:34

    30분 동안 생성된 세션은 사용자가 30분 이상 작동하지 않으면 만료된다는 의미입니다. 사용자가 서버와 상호 작용하지 않으면 만료되지 않습니다. 즉, 세션에 마지막으로 액세스한 이후의 시간입니다.

    회신하다
    0
  • 过去多啦不再A梦

    过去多啦不再A梦2017-05-17 10:09:34

    다른 언어의 세션 원칙은 유사해야 합니다.
    PHP를 예로 들면, 가장 중요한 것은 会话cookie的过期时间会话文件的过期时间:
    1 세션 쿠키(session.cookie_lifetime)의 만료 시간이 0임을 의미합니다. 세션 쿠키는 브라우저가 닫히면 만료됩니다.
    2. 세션 파일 만료 시간(session.gc_maxlifetime)의 기준점은 세션 파일 생성 시간(create_time)이 아닌 마지막 업데이트 시간(update_time)입니다. .

    회신하다
    0
  • 취소회신하다